WWW服务器的配置过程
第八章www服务器的配置与管理

1
WWW的基本概念 IIS概述 安装WWW服务器 配置与管理WWW服务器
2
一.WWW 的基本概念
World Wide Web,也称Web 、 WWW 、万维网,是 Internet 上集文本、声音、动画等多种媒体信息于一 身的信息服务系统, WWW中的信息资源主要由一篇篇 的网页为基本元素构成,所有网页采用超文本标记语 言(HTML)来编写,HTML对Web页的内容、格式及Web 页中的超链接进行描述。
6
* FTP服务:通过该服务可以建立FTP站点,为用 户提供文件上传及下载的功能。 * NNTP服务:即新闻组传输服务,通过该服务, 可以创建新闻组。 * SMTP服务:即简单邮件传输服务,通过它,可 以为用户提供发送邮件的功能。
7
三.安装WWW服务器(即安装IIS) IIS 安装要求
8
IIS 安装方法
开始/控制面板/添加或删除程序/添加 删除Windows 组件/应用程序服务/详细信 息/Internet 信息服务(IIS)复选框/详 细信息/万维网服务/确定
9
四.配置与管理 WWW 服务器
服务器端的配置 开始/程序/管理工具/ Internet信息服务管理 器/ 详细信息/ Internet 信息服务(IIS)管理 器/展开网站/右击网站/新建虚拟目录 客户端的配置 只需客户端与服务器端在同一网断。 注:无须配置DNS
10
课堂练习: 安装并配置WWW服务器,创建Web站点, 使客户机可以浏览Sina主页 Nhomakorabea11
12
3
www的服务过程
启动web客户程序,即浏览器,输入客户想 查看的web页的地址,客户程序与该地址的服 务器连通,并告诉服务器需要哪一页,服务器 将该页面发送给客户程序,客户程序显示该页 面内容,这时客户就可以浏览该页面了。
第11章 WWW服务器的配置

第12 页
11.3 虚拟目录
实际目录: Web网站中的网页及其相关文件可以全 实际目录: Web网站中的网页及其相关文件可以全 部存储在网站的主目录下, 部存储在网站的主目录下,也可以在主目录下建立 多个子文件夹, 多个子文件夹,然后按网站不同栏目或不同网页文 件类型,分别存放到各个子文件中。 件类型,分别存放到各个子文件中。 然而随着网站内容的不断丰富, 然而随着网站内容的不断丰富,主目录所在分区的 空间可能会不足。 空间可能会不足。
第3 页
(Tim Berners-Lee)
2011年12月24日星期六 年 月 日星期六
Windows 网络操作系统
11.1 WWW服务概述 WWW服务概述
11.1.1 WWW的基本概念 WWW的基本概念 WWW是 WWW是World Wide Web(环球信息网)的缩写, Web(环球信息网)的缩写, 经常表述为Web、3W或W3,中文名字为“ 经常表述为Web、3W或W3,中文名字为“万维 网”。 WWW通过 超文本传输协议” HTTP, WWW通过“超文本传输协议”(HTTP, 通过“ HyperText Tarnsfer Protocol)向用户提供多媒 Protocol) 体信息,这些信息的基本单位是网页, 体信息,这些信息的基本单位是网页,每一个网页 可包含文字、图像、动画、声音、视频等多种信息。 可包含文字、图像、动画、声音、视频等多种信息。 采用“统一资源定位符” 采用“统一资源定位符”(URL Uniform Resource Locator)来惟一标识和定位网页信息, Locator)来惟一标识和定位网页信息, 通用的URL描述格式为 描述格式为: 通用的URL描述格式为:
2011年12月24日星期六 年 月 日星期六
2、配置WWW服务器

配置、管理WWW服务一、实验目的1.学会用Windows2003Server建立WWW服务器2.掌握WWW服务配置中的主要参数及其作用3.掌握WWW服务器配置和管理过程二、实验内容新建一个Web站点,使其访问端口为默认的80,主目录为C:\myweb,并设置相应的访问权限及默认文档。
三、实验环境交换机(集线器)1台服务器(安装Windows2003Server系统)1台工作站(安装Windows XP Professional系统)1台双绞线(T568B标准)若干中文Windows2003Server安装光盘1张四、实验步骤u在服务器上安装WWW组件信息。
u启动WWW服务。
u查看默认Web站点设置。
u Web站点的配置及管理。
u通过工作站来对发布的站点进行测试。
1.安装I I S以管理员(A d mi n i s t r a t or)的身份登录服务器,在服务器上完成一下操作:步骤1单击"开始",指向"设置",单击"控制面板",然后启动"添加/删除程序"应用程序。
步骤2选择"添加/删除Windows组件"按钮,然后出现如图1.1的页面。
步骤3选中Internet信息服务(IIS)后,点击下一步,放入Windows2000Server 的光盘,系统自动安装该服务。
2.设置W W W服务打开Internet信息服务管理器,单击开始程序管理工具,然后单击Internet 信息服务器。
如图1.2步骤1选中默认Web站点,右键属性打开如图1.3,并为其选择IP地址(本机的IP地址)步骤2选择主目录选项卡,指定所发布网站的存储位置,如图1.4。
步骤3选择文档选项卡,如图1.5。
检查发布网站的主页是否为Default.htm,Default.asp,iisstart.asp,如果不是的话,要进行添加。
选择完毕后,确定即可。
WWW服务器的安装与配置

WWW服务器的安装与配置WWW服务器的安装与配置1、硬件需求1.1、服务器1.2、网络设备1.3、存储设备2、软件需求2.1、操作系统2.2、WWW服务器软件2.3、数据库引擎3、安装操作系统3.1、确定合适的操作系统版本3.2、操作系统镜像文件3.3、创建安装媒介3.4、安装操作系统3.5、执行必要的操作系统配置4、安装WWW服务器软件4.1、WWW服务器软件4.2、安装WWW服务器软件4.3、配置WWW服务器软件的基本设置4.4、测试WWW服务器的运行状态5、安装数据库引擎5.1、数据库引擎软件5.2、安装数据库引擎软件5.3、配置数据库引擎的基本设置5.4、测试数据库引擎的运行状态6、配置WWW服务器与数据库引擎的连接6.1、配置WWW服务器软件的数据库连接设置6.2、测试WWW服务器与数据库引擎的连接7、配置WWW服务器的网站设置7.1、创建网站目录7.2、配置虚拟主机7.3、配置SSL证书7.4、配置网站访问权限7.5、配置日志记录8、高级配置8.1、配置负载均衡8.2、配置缓存策略8.3、配置反向代理8.4、配置安全性加固附件:附件1:操作系统镜像文件附件2:WWW服务器软件附件3:数据库引擎软件法律名词及注释:1、版权:保护原创作品的独立权利。
2、商标:对特定商品或服务的标识权利。
3、隐私权:个人或组织对于其个人信息的保护权利。
4、数据保护:处理个人数据时的合法性、正确性和安全性的保护措施。
5、法律责任:由违反法律规定而导致的责任。
WWW服务器的配置1

一、WWW服务器的配置:1。
启动Microsoft管理控制台。
用户通过执行Windows2000Sever的“开始”“程序”“管理工具”“Interner服务管理器”命令便可启动Microsoft的管理控制台。
2。
新建Web站点。
选择要在其中建立Web站点的主机,然后单击“活动工具栏”中的“操作”按扭,在出现的菜单中的选择“新建”先面的“Web站点”一项,“Web站点创建向导”对话框就会出现在屏幕上。
按照“Web站点创建向导”的要求,分别输入“Web站点说明”、“Web站点使用的。
IP地址”、“TC P端口”、“主目录路径”、“权限”等信息。
3。
Web站点的启动与停止。
4。
创建虚拟目录。
选择要创建虚拟目录的站点,然后单击“活动工具栏”中的“操作”,选择“新建”下面的“虚拟目录”,然后按照“虚拟目录创建向导”的要求,完成。
5。
设置Web站点标志。
在需要设置的站点上右击,选择“属性”;在“Web站点标志”区域可以修改Web站点的相关信息。
此外,你还可以对其他内容进行设置。
6。
指定Web站点的操作员。
在你所建立的站点上,右击“属性”,点击“操作员”,单击“添加”,选择用户或者是组进行添加。
7。
在“属性”中,你还可以进行主目录,默认文档的设置。
8。
站点的访问控制的级别的设置,IP地址与域名限制的设置……二、Web Browser中文名称:网络浏览器或网页浏览器,简称浏览器英文名称:Web Browser浏览器是个显示网页伺服器或档案系统内的HTML文件,并让用户与此些文件互动的一种软件。
个人电脑上常见的网页浏览器包括微软的Internet Explorer、Mozilla 的Firefox、Opera和Safari。
浏览器是最经常使用到的客户端程序。
协定和标准网页浏览器主要通过HTTP协议连接网页伺服器而取得网页,HTTP容许网页浏览器送交资料到网页伺服器并且获取网页。
目前最常用的HTTP是HTTP/1.1,这个协议在RFC2616中被完整定义。
WWW服务器的安装和配置

实验一 WWW服务器的安装与配置 一、实验目的1.掌握WWW服务器的安装与配置方法。
2.掌握默认Web站点、管理Web站点和添加新的Web站点的设置。
3.掌握一台WWW服务器发布多个网站(在Windows Server下)或多个虚拟目录(在Windows XP下)的方法。
二、实验报告1.写出WWW服务器的安装与配置过程。
(1).WWW服务器的安装右击‘我的电脑’;打开‘管理’;从服务和应用程序中查看是否安装IIS(如下图)由此图可知本台机器已安装IIS*如需安装则执行以下步骤1、 进入控制面板——>添加删除组件,如下图。
2、 选择安装IIS3、 如需进一步的详细信息,请点击“详细信息”,如下图。
注:如果选中文件传输服务项,如上图所示,则同时安装了FTP服务,相关实验会用到该功能,建议选择安装。
4、 进入安装界面。
5、 依次点击“下一步”,由于通过独立安装包,当系统给出需要从光盘安装的信息后,点击“确定”,如下图。
6、 通过“浏览”定位到IIS独立安装包文件夹下。
9、找到安装文件。
(只需按步骤操作选择当前文件即可)7、 安装过程会多次出现要求从光盘安装的信息,依次定位到独立安装包的相应文件上即可。
8、 完成安装。
(2)WWW服务器的配置过程1)进入IIS管理界面右击‘我的电脑’;选择‘管理’;打开‘服务和应用程序’中‘Internet信息服务’中选择‘默认网站’2)设置“默认站点”(向所有人开放的WWW站点)各选项右击‘默认网站’选择‘属性’在“IP地址”栏输入10.4.202.43(本机IP地址);点击如上图所示的“主目录”标签,得到如下图界面。
点“浏览”按钮定位到你好建立网站的文件夹位置。
在“本地路径”通过“浏览”按钮来选择你的网页文件所在的目录e:\ jokealbum。
点击确定即可2.写出如果希望一台主机发布多个网站时,应用如何解决。
一种办法是主机IP地址是1个,但是可以设置不同的端口,默认网站www服务的端口是80,可以设置在其他端口,这样多个网站访问时就不会冲突。
第3章WWW服务器的配置和管理

3.4 案例分析 3.5 本章小结
3.1 WWW概述
3.1.1 万维网
万维网WWW(World Wide Web)简称Web, 也称3W,是一个支持交互式访问的分布式超 媒体系统。 超文本与超媒体的差异在于文档内容:超文本 文档仅含有文本信息,而超媒体文档除了含有 含有文本信息外,还包括图片、音乐、动画 等。 分布式的与非分布式的超媒体系统的区别。
例如
/sinahelp/2003-10-28/113/314.html
协议类型 主机域名 路径及文件名
图3-1 URL的一般形式
端口号80是WWW服务器进程的熟知端口号 在这里可以省略。
3.2.2 超文本传输协议
客户端和服务器之间的传输协议为超文本传 送协议简称为“HTTP” HTTP协议规定了在浏览器和服务器之间的请 求和响应的交互过程必须遵守的规则 HTTP服务器进程的80号TCP端口始终处于监 听状态,以便发现是否有浏览器向它发出建 立连接的请求。一旦监听到连接建立请求, 并建立了TCP连接后,浏览器就向服务器发 出浏览某个页面的请求,服务器找到该网页 后,就返回所请求的页面作为响应。通信结 束,释放TCP连接。
3.2 WWW工作原理
万维网必须解决以下几个问题:
怎样标志分布在整个因特网上的万维网文档? 用什么样的协议来实现万维网上网页文件的传 输? 怎样使不同作者创作的不同风格的网页文件都 能在因特网上的各种计算机上显示出来,同时 使用户清楚地知道在什么地方存在着超链接? 怎样使用户能够很方便地找到所需的信息?
3.1.2 WWW服务
在Internet上最热门的服务之一,人们在网 上查找、浏览信息的主要手段。 WWW服务的主要特点:
以超文本方式组织网络多媒体信息,用户可 以访问文本、语音、图形和视频信息; 用户可以在Internet范围内的任意网站之间 查询、检索、浏览及发布信息,并实现对各 种信息资源透明的访问; 提供生动、直观、统一的图形用户界面;
WWW服务器的配置

3-3-25
进程间通信文件
CUUG
Httpd守护进程的加锁文件。 LockFile /usr/local/httpd/logs/httpd.lock 进程文件:指定记录服务器进程号的文件 PidFile logs/httpd.pid 控制服务器与父进程和子进程通信的文件 ScoreBoardFile logs/httpd.scoreboard
1. 安装后产生的目录
bin:存放Apache的可执行程序 cgi-bin:公共网关接口程序,用于存放用户的CGI程序 conf:配置文件存放的目录 htdocs:默认的存放用户页面的目录 icons:存放图标的目录 logs:存放日志的目录
2. Apache的配置文件
httpd.conf: httpd守护进程在启动时读取该文件 access.conf:对于WWW资源访问实施控制的文件 srm.conf:数据设置文件,设置WWW服务器读取文件的目录、CGI执 行的目录等 3-3-23
3-3-29
服务器端口设置
CUUG
端口设置: 指定HTTP协议接收客户请求的端口,默认80 Port 80 定义了Standalone模式下httpd守护进程使用的端口,该选项只对独 立方式启动服务器才有效。对于以inetd方式启动的服务器在 inetd.conf中定义使用哪个端口。 指定HTTP协议监听的端口,默认监听所有IP地址和由port指令指 定的端口。格式: Listen 端口 Listen IP地址:端口
UNIX使用与网络管理
——WWW服务器配置 ——WWW服务器配置
CUUG
中国UNIX用户协会培训中心
版权所有, 2004 (c) 中国UNIX用户协会培训中心 Facesmile
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
一、实验目的
通过本次实验,让读者了解Windows 2000下的WWW服务器的配置过程,并学会建立一个网页,并设置其为主页,以及相对路径和绝对路径的概念,从而加深对计算机网络课程这部分章节的理解。
二、实验所需的设备
两台已连成局域网的计算机,一台作WWW服务器,另外一台作客户机。
三、实验要求
建立一个WWW服务器。
要求:
(1)在一个Web服务器上建立两个Web站点,一个是默认Web站点,端口号是80,另一个端口号是8080,并分别显示两个不同的主页,并通过浏览器能分别访问. (2)建立一个虚拟目录,显示另一个Web页
(3)对某些IP地址不允许访问
(4)设置不同的主文档
四、实验原理
Web服务器是可以向发出请求的浏览器提供文档的程序。
1、服务器是一种被动程序:只有当Internet上运行在其他计算机中的浏览器发出请求时,服务器才会响应。
2 、最常用的Web服务器是Apache和Microsoft的Internet信息服务器(Internet Information Services,IIS)。
3、Internet上的服务器也称为Web服务器,是一台在Internet上具有独立IP地址的计算机,可以向Internet上的客户机提供WWW、Email和FTP等各种Internet服务。
4、Web服务器是指驻留于因特网上某种类型计算机的程序。
当Web浏览器(客户端)连到服务器上并请求文件时,服务器将处理该请求并将文件反馈到该浏览器上,附带的信息会告诉浏览器如何查看该文件(即文件类型)。
服务器使用HTTP(超文本传输协议)与客户机浏览器进行信息交流,这就是人们常把它们称为HTTP服务器的原因。
Web服务器不仅能够存储信息,还能在用户通过Web浏览器提供的信息的基础上运行脚本和程序。
Web服务器的工作原理并不复杂,一般可分成如下4个步骤:连接过程、请求过程、应答过程以及关闭连接。
连接过程就是Web服务器和其浏览器之间所建立起来的一种连接。
查看连接过程是否实现,用户可以找到和打开socket这个虚拟文件,这个文件的建立意味着连接过程这一步骤已经成功建立。
请求过程就是Web的浏览器运用socket
这个文件向其服务器而提出各种请求。
应答过程就是运用HTTP协议把在请求过程中所提出来的请求传输到Web 的服务器,进而实施任务处理,然后运用HTTP协议把任务处理的结果传输到Web的浏览器,同时在Web的浏览器上面展示上述所请求之界面。
关闭连接就是当上一个步骤--应答过程完成以后,Web服务器和其浏览器之间断开连接之过程。
Web服务器上述4个步骤环环相扣、紧密相联,逻辑性比较强,可以支持多个进程、多个线程以及多个进程与多个线程相混合的技术。
五、实验步骤
1.在虚拟主机上安装IIS服务,进入IIS服务后右键默认网站后选择属性,在属性中设置IP为19
2.168.1.110,端口号为80,后选择文档(我将其他文档都删了,只留下一个主要显示的文档,显示当前的信息,也可以不删,但必需有一个文档);
2.在虚拟实验机上的IE输入192.168.1.110能访问到设置的文档;
3.右键点击网站后新建网站,设置为8080端口,IP还是192.168.1.110,设置好文档;
4.在虚拟实验机上的IE输入192.168.1.110:8080即可显示8080端口对应的网站;5.右键点击默认网站(当然也可以在自己新建的网站下新建虚拟目录)后选择新建虚拟目录,设置目录后,选择显示的文档;
6. 在虚拟实验机上的IE输入192.168.1.110/WenTest/WenTest.htm能访问到设置的文档;
7.对于限制特定IP我们可以在计算机的管理工具中选择本地安全策略,创建IP 安全策略,给这个安全策略取名后完成创建,在IP筛选器中将要限制的IP添加,选择筛选器操作为阻止后保存;
8.用实验机访问访问不了。
六、实验验证
七、实验总结
首先在虚拟主机上要安装IIS服务,安装后在IIS中设置默认网站和网站的IP (即是虚拟主机的IP,之前的实验中设置的是192.168.1.110),再设置主目录和文档,文档由于实验,我改了一部分,使得实验目的更加明白直观,设置的端口是80。
要设置成8080段口需要重新新建一个网站,IP不变,但是需要将端口号改成8080,设置显示文档。
新建目录则在默认网站的基础上新建一个虚拟目录,实验中我建立的为WenTest,也需要进行设置文档,方便访问,我也改了内容,最后只需要在局域网中的实验机器上输入服务器的IP即可访问到服务器的文档。
并且由于虚拟服务器有设置DNS,并且设置中我将 与192.168.1.110进行正反解析设置了,所以当我在虚拟实验机IE中输入能访问80端口对应的文档。
八、问题
请说明设置WWW服务器时设置端口的作用?
答:通过设置不同的端口可以实现不同的服务,各种服务采用不同的端口分别提供不同的服务,通常TCP/IP协议规定Web采用80号端口,FTP采用21号端口等,而邮件服务器是采用25号端口。
这样,通过不同端口,计算机就可以与外界进行互不干扰的通信。